This solicitation, numbered 1232SA26Q0949, is a combined synopsis and request for quotation for range building renovations under FAR Part 12, exclusively set aside for small business concerns with a size standard of $19.0 million and classified under NAICS code 238990. All responsible small businesses may submit quotations, and no separate written solicitation will be issued. The work is to be performed in Dubois, Idaho, with proposals due by August 14, 2026, at 10:00 PM Mountain Daylight Time. Bid, payment, and performance bonds are mandatory for award. Organized site visits are scheduled for July 21 and 22, 2026, in MDT, and while attendance is not required, it is strongly encouraged to fully understand site conditions; registration for attendance must be completed by July 20, 2026, via email with attendee details and a government-issued photo ID will be required upon arrival. All queries must be submitted in writing to the Contracting Officer, Josh Dobereiner, no later than July 31, 2026, with AI-generated questions excluded; no telephone inquiries will be addressed. Technical documentation including the Statement of Work and Wage Determination are provided as attachments. Definitization of equitable adjustments for change orders follows USDA’s policies under AGAR 443.304-70 and FAR 36.101-4(b). The performing office is the USDA ARS AFM APD located in Beltsville, Maryland.

AMENDMENT 01 - 08/10/2026


Solicitation is amended to post the site visit sign-in sheets and responses to all requests for information (RFIs) received by the RFI deadline.  All other terms and conditions remain unchanged.


Acknowledgement of amendment is required with quote submission by either returning a signed copy of the SF-30 or completing section 19 on the SF-1442.


END OF AMENDMENT 01


____________________________________________________________


This is a combined synopsis/solicitation for commercial items prepared in accordance with the format in FAR Part 12.  This announcement constitutes the only solicitation.  Quotations are being requested and a separate written solicitation will not be issued. 


Solicitation number 1232SA26Q0949 is issued as a Request for Quotation (RFQ) for range building renovations.


This acquisition  is set-aside for small business concerns.  The applicable North American Industry Classification Standard Code is 238990.  The small business size standard is $19.0 million.  This acquisition is a Total Small Business Set-Aside.  All responsible sources may submit a quotation which will be considered by the agency. 


Organized site visits have been scheduled for July 21, 2026 at 10:00 AM Mountain Daylight Time (MDT) and July 22, 2026 at 2:00 PM MDT.  The same information will be provided at both site visits, so offerors only need to attend one.  Contractors wishing to attend the site visit must register by emailing jennifer.barnett@usda.gov by July 20, 2026 at 4:00 PM MDT with the name(s) of attendee(s), company they are with, and company(s) they are representing.  A Government issued photo ID is required for attendance.


The site visit will be held for the purpose of providing contractors with the opportunity to familiarize themselves with the site, which may be helpful in the preparation of quotes.  Attendance at the site visit is not mandatory for quote submission; however, failure to visit the site will not relieve or mitigate the successful contractor’s responsibility and obligation to fully comply with the terms, conditions, and specifications contained and/or referenced in this document.


Bonds:  Bid, Payment, and Performance Bonds are required.


All questions regarding this solicitation must be submitted in writing to the Contracting Officer, Josh Dobereiner, via email to josh.dobereiner@usda.gov.  Questions must be submitted no later than July 31, 2026 at 4:00 PM MDT.  Answers to all questions received by that time will be posted as an amendment to the solicitation.  No questions will be answered after this date unless determined to be in the best interest of the Government as deemed by the Contracting Officer.  Questions generated by artificial intelligence will not be answered.  The Contracting Officer will make the sole and final determination on what questions deem a response.  Telephone requests for information will not be accepted or returned.


Technical data and supporting documentation associated with this solicitation are included as attachments to this solicitation and can be accesses via the “Attachments/Links” section of the posting:


  • Statement of Work
  • Wage Determination

Definitization of Equitable Adjustments for Change Orders


Pursuant to FAR 36.101-4(b), information regarding USDA’s definitization of equitable adjustments for change orders under construction contracts may be found at https://www.usda.gov/about-usda/general-information/staff-offices/departmental-administration/office-contracting-and-procurement-ocp/policies-regulations under “Federal Acquisition Regulation 36.101-4”.  USDA’s procedures that apply to the definitization of equitable adjustments for change orders under construction contracts may be found in AGAR 443.304 -70.
